SMPS works by turning the main power on and off at a high speed to reduce the voltage. In such a case the reduction in voltage depends on the ratio of time and off time. Switching happens very quickly, 10,000 times or faster per second. What is SMPS’s short answer? SMPS stands for Switch-Mode-Power-Supply.

Web10 de ago. de 2016 · So the larger the duty cycle, the higher the average DC output voltage from the switch mode power supply. From this we can also see that the output voltage will always be lower than the input voltage since the duty cycle, D can never reach one (unity) resulting in a step-down voltage regulator. Web12 de abr. de 2024 · Switching Power Supply. A type of power supply that works by switching current into a high- frequency transformer or inductor at frequencies much higher than the input or line frequency (60 Hz in the U.S.).
